Data Engineer – AWS Bedrock & Microsoft Fabric

Location: Canada / United States (Remote)

Type: Contract

Overview

A leading energy-sector enterprise is seeking 1–2 experienced Data Engineers / Data Scientists to join a growing data and AI team. This role will support the advancement of AI-enabled use cases and a strategic migration from AWS Redshift to Microsoft Fabric as the organization’s go-forward enterprise data lake.

This is a hands-on development role working closely alongside Business Analysts and data stakeholders, ideal for candidates with strong data engineering fundamentals and practical experience across AWS Bedrock and Microsoft Fabric.

Team & Working Model
  • You will work as 1 of 1–2 Data Engineers / Data Scientists supporting a team of 3 Business Analysts
  • Fully remote is acceptable due to the development-focused nature of the role
  • Candidates must be aligned to MDT working hours
Key Responsibilities
  • Design, build, and optimize scalable data pipelines and data services supporting analytics and AI workloads
  • Implement and support data engineering components leveraging AWS Bedrock
  • Contribute to the development and operationalization of AWS Bedrock AgentCore (limited exposure is acceptable)
  • Support the migration of the enterprise data lake from AWS Redshift to Microsoft Fabric
  • Develop and maintain data models, ingestion pipelines, and transformations within Microsoft Fabric
  • Ensure data quality, performance, security, and governance across cloud data platforms
  • Collaborate closely with Business Analysts, data scientists, and architects to translate business requirements into technical solutions
Required Qualifications
  • Strong Data Engineering background with proven hands-on experience in development-focused roles
  • Experience working with AWS Bedrock (core requirement)
  • Exposure to AWS Bedrock AgentCore (up to ~6 months of experience is acceptable)
  • Hands-on experience with Microsoft Fabric, including data engineering or lakehouse workloads
  • Experience supporting or executing data platform migrations (, Redshift to Fabric or similar)
  • Strong SQL skills and experience working with large-scale datasets
  • Experience operating in modern, cloud-based data architectures
Nice to Have
  • Experience supporting AI/ML or GenAI-driven platforms
  • Familiarity with Databricks or adjacent analytics tools
  • Background in energy, utilities, or other asset-intensive enterprises
  • Experience working closely with business-facing teams (, BAs, product owners)
